Ivalo Airport is a small regional airport located in Ivalo, Finland. It serves as the main gateway to the northernmost part of the country and is an important hub for travelers looking to explore the stunning Finnish Lapland region.
The airport is situated approximately 11 kilometers southwest of Ivalo town and provides essential air transport connections for both passengers and cargo. Despite its remote location, Ivalo Airport plays a crucial role in supporting tourism and local communities in the area.
With a single asphalt runway, Ivalo Airport is capable of handling a modest amount of air traffic. The main terminal building offers essential facilities for passengers, including check-in counters, security checkpoints, and baggage claim areas. Additionally, there are car rental services, a café, and a souvenir shop available for visitors.
